LOGAN — It was a bit of a bummer of a trip for Captain Aggie, but don’t expect him to quit cheering on his team.
That would be un-Aggie like. Win or lose, Andy Pedersen — also known as Captain Aggie — will not give up on Utah State University athletics. Cheering for his team has been a way of life for more than four decades.
“I’ve been an Aggie for 44 years,” Pedersen said. “I’ve watched highs and lows. It’s been real fun.”
Captain Aggie arrived in Las Vegas March 13 to cheer on the USU men’s and women’s basketball teams at the Western Athletic Conference Tournament. He had an enjoyable time leading USU fans in his chants of: “A-G-G-I-E-S, what does it spell? Aggies, Aggies, Aggies.”
